Output 13ca8edec59769c20e57d30fdc602a5c3ec675fd3fbfdd61fbdc6c0de409ce21:0

value
26072856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d09c6bd7612d0aa42df1c830887f3581027dd28 OP_EQUALVERIFY OP_CHECKSIG
address
19UwZ7TsuZDoGduHxs4zEaJayLJSjC4D6P
transaction
13ca8edec59769c20e57d30fdc602a5c3ec675fd3fbfdd61fbdc6c0de409ce21
spent
true